The guesthouse "Zur Kloster-Mühle" is a hotel in a paradisiacal location in Groß Meckelsen - Kuhmühlen in the municipality of Sittensen.
Our house impresses its visitors with a harmonious mix of modern interior design in a classic, lavishly restored building. Exposed ceiling beams, free-standing bathtubs and many other elements exude a rustic charm. Large windows and the view of the idyllic park invite you to dream and relax. You can also enjoy regional and Mediterranean dishes in our restaurant.
After a restful night, guests can enjoy a delicious breakfast with a view of the greenery or simply right by the mill pond, without any fixed breakfast times. A blessing for stressed souls!

The hotel is located in Kuhmühlen, near the town of Sittensen.
Coming by car from Hamburg:
Drive south from Hamburg and then take the A1 towards Bremen. Leave the highway at the Sittensen exit. Only 1 km away, between the villages of Groß and Klein Meckelsen, you will reach the turn-off to Kuhmühlen.
By car coming from Bremen:
Take the A1 from Bremen in the direction of Hamburg. Leave the highway at the Sittensen exit. Only 1 km away, between the villages of Groß and Klein Meckelsen, you will reach the turn-off to Kuhmühlen.
Travel by train and bus:
The "Metronom" takes you from Hamburg main station and Bremen main station to Tostedt station. From there, the "Oste-Sprinter" bus line 3860 runs to Groß Meckelsen from Monday to Saturday.

The "Kuhmühlen" watermill can look back on a long history. Powered by the waters of the Kuhbach stream, the mill was built 750 years ago and extended over the years to include a manor house. After operations ceased in 1960, the architect Gerhard Klindworth acquired the historic half-timbered ensemble in 1986 and restored it with great attention to detail.
Enjoy this unique gem and combine your stay with a hike on the NORDPFAD Kuhbach-Oste, which leads right past the hotel.
